2018 F-150 5.0 - Engine Rattle and Oil Consumption

Ford F-150 2018 5.0 Coyote 127000 miles
I have a 2018 Ford F-150 5.0L. My truck has developed an engine rattle, especially at idle and when letting off the accelerator. I've also noticed that the engine oil level slowly drops over time. While inspecting the engine, I found a small amount of oil around what appears to be a sensor or electrical component on the front driver's side valve cover. I cleaned the area, but after a few weeks a small amount of oil came back. There are no visible oil leaks underneath the truck and there is currently no check engine light. Has anyone experienced these same symptoms? What ended up being the cause?

Could be broken timing parts as far as slides and guides and your chain is slapping inside of the front of the casing on the front of the motor as that sensor is either your VCT or your cam sensor it syncs with the crank sensor I’m not sure which one a coyote has. I’ve never owned one, but if you’ve got a really loud rattle at idle, and when you let off that normally means either phases or timing or really badly it could be a bad rocker/bent lifter where the rocker bearing wore out and bitch just popped out of place and or bent to lift a rod basically and just enough to make it hit the sidewall of its guide just enough to make a rattle bit more than likely it’s either your phaser Bank two phaser or your whole timing set. Definitely get a lift as soon as possible. Otherwise it could a new engine minimum.
